Sundridge Park's Girls 12's Put Up a Fantasic fight!

The Girls 12's team comprising of Maria Manta, Annabel Nuijens, Aukse Paskauskaite & Iona Ibe-Spence took Sevenoaks's A (one of the favourite's for the Kent Inter Club title) to the wire in their match played on Sunday. Maria and Annabel notched up 2 brilliant wins in the their singles. Aukse lost a cliff-hanger singles and all other matches were extremely close. The Girls lost 4-2, but were so close to pulling off a great victory. Two happy girls after their singles matches!

Big Welcome to Anna

We are delighted to announce that WAM Tennis has a new coach - Anna Chwiejczak!

Anna will be joining us, as of the 21st April, and comes to us from Bromley Lawn Tennis Club. Anna was a nationally ranked player in her native Poland and is a Level 3 coach, working towards Level 4. Anna will be Head of Performance Coaching and we are so excited to have her join us.

Anna will be available for private coaching as well as leading many established junior and adults sessions. She will also be leading our popular Friday Family Night sessions which will recommence on Friday 28th April!

Red Nose Juniors v Adults Davis Cup Challenge at Sundridge Park!

We had an exceptional turnout for the juniors v adults Red Nose Davis Cup challenge, with the juniors taking victory, despite the adults winning the last relay event (with some clever manipulation of the rules!)

Special thanks to all that made cakes, Carolyn Everitt, Anna Wilson and everyone else that helped out. A huge thank you to Louise Anand (Loonar Designs) for doing the face painting (which was incredible!) at no charge to the Club.

The Club raised £400 for Red Nose and took £800 behind the bar. The clubhouse was rocking all evening and a fantastic time was had by all!
